Give the award of a lifetime!! Every year, Robinson PTA has the opportunity to select 2 individuals to recognize with a Texas PTA Honorary Lifetime Membership Award, which is one of Texas PTA’s highest form of recognition. These are awarded to folks who go above and beyond for the good of the school, all students and their families/communities. This year, help us recognize 2 more individuals by nominating them for this prestigious award.
There is no other requirement needed. They also do not need to be a member of the PTA to be nominated.
